#49be3e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#49be3e is composed of 28.6% red, 74.5%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.4%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 114.8 degrees, a saturation of 50.8% and a lightness of 49.4%. #49be3e color hex could be obtained by blending #92ff7c with #007d00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#49be3e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050d04 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#49be3e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#798478 is the less saturated color, while #19f804 is the most saturated one.
